seems I'll have to convince him to change ISP
Well, you didn't mention it, but I assume you've tried to resolve the issue through AOL support channels with no success ? A bit far fetched, but it might, just might, be some sort of temporary problem ?

How good Sky are I don't know, but I haven't heard anything bad about them myself.
Sky bought Easynet, who were a very well respected business service that also ran the excellent UKOnline service for home users.

I've not had any experience of the Sky products for home users, but the products sold for businesses under the Easynet brand continue to be excellent.

If Sky give you the option as a home user, try to ensure you're getting an LLU broadband line. LLU on the Easynet network is so much better than the BT Broadband that every man and his dog sells as a re-branded product.
